Vitajte na [www.pocitac.win] Pripojiť k domovskej stránke Obľúbené stránky
Tu sú hlavné charakteristiky algoritmu:
1. Vstup :Algoritmy prijímajú určitý vstup, ktorým môže byť čokoľvek od čísel a znakov až po dátové štruktúry alebo dokonca objekty reálneho sveta.
2. Výstup :Algoritmy vytvárajú nejaký výstup, ktorým môže byť čokoľvek od jednej hodnoty alebo súboru hodnôt až po úplné riešenie problému.
3. Presnosť :Algoritmy sú presné a jednoznačné. Každý krok algoritmu musí byť jasne definovaný a vykonateľný bez akýchkoľvek nejasností.
4. Konečnost :Algoritmy sa musia ukončiť po konečnom počte krokov. Nemali by bežať donekonečna alebo zacykliť donekonečna bez toho, aby priniesli výsledok.
5. Účinnosť :Algoritmy musia byť účinné pri dosahovaní požadovaného výsledku alebo pri riešení zamýšľaného problému. Mali by produkovať správny výstup v rámci primeraného času a využitia zdrojov.
Algoritmy zohrávajú kľúčovú úlohu v informatike a používajú sa na riešenie širokého spektra problémov. Často sú implementované ako počítačové programy alebo implementované v hardvérových obvodoch na vykonávanie špecifických úloh. Efektívne a optimalizované algoritmy sú nevyhnutné pre efektívne fungovanie softvéru, hardvéru a mnohých reálnych aplikácií.